The btrace state is stored in the thread_info. So, when trying to determine whether we are currently replaying, GDB calls find_thread_ptid() to obtain the thread_info. It also asserts that we do have a thread_info. For new threads, libthread-db may fetch registers before the thread is known to GDB. In this case, find_thread_ptid() returns nullptr and the assertion fails.
